1. Classic 1950s Retro Flocked Tree

The 1950s Christmas look never gets old—bright colors, bold shapes, and shiny ornaments that sparkle against snowy branches.

How to style it:

  • Shiny Brite ornaments in red, teal, and gold
  • Starburst toppers and tinsel strands
  • Warm yellow string lights
  • Red felt or velvet tree skirt

2. Victorian-Inspired Flocked Christmas Tree

Victorian décor pairs beautifully with a flocked tree because rich colors contrast perfectly against snowy branches.

Style Essentials:

  • Burgundy or emerald velvet ribbon
  • Lace ornaments and brass bells
  • Candle-style lights
  • Dried fruits and natural elements

5. Antique Gold & White Flocked Christmas Tree

This theme highlights warm gold tones against snowy white branches for a classy, heirloom feel.

Add these touches:

  • Gold mercury-glass ornaments
  • White poinsettias
  • Gold-beaded garlands
  • Angel or gold star topper

Extra Tips for a Perfect Vintage Flocked Tree

✔ Use Warm Lights

Yellow-toned lights make decorations glow softly.

✔ Add Metallic Tinsel

Instant mid-century sparkle!

✔ Vintage-Inspired Tree Skirt

Choose velvet, quilted fabric, lace, or faux fur.

✔ Add Decorations Around the Base

Try vintage toys, nutcrackers, and lanterns.

✔ Mix Ornament Textures

Glass, metal, fabric, and wood add depth and authenticity.

Flocked Tree Maintenance Tips

  • Avoid over-handling to reduce shedding
  • Use a small vacuum for fallen flocking
  • Store properly in a dry place
  • Keep away from moisture

With care, your flocked tree will stay beautiful for many years.
